Coffee Blocks Sorting is a puzzle where you need to fill every colored block on the level with coffee.
The board has gates (coffee sources) and channels. You drag coaster-style blocks and place them on the grid. When a block is in the right spot and connected to a gate by a channel, coffee starts filling the block. The goal is to fill every block with coffee; when all blocks are full, the level is complete.
Blocks come in different colors and shapes, and there are special types: double blocks (you must fill two “layers”), ice blocks, keys, and switches. On some levels there is dynamite—a timer starts, and if you don’t fill the blocks in time, it explodes and you fail the level.
There is a shop with boosters (e.g. wrench, vacuum, block swap, saw) that help in tough situations. The game suits short sessions and fans of relaxed puzzle games.
How to play
1. Level goal — Fill every colored block on the board with coffee. When every block is fully filled, the level is complete.
2. Moving blocks
Tap a block and drag it across the grid. Release it in the right spot.
3. Filling with coffee
When a block is in the correct position—next to the matching color—coffee automatically flows into the block and fills its cells. Wait until it’s fully filled; then the block disappears from the board.
4. Special blocks
Double blocks must be filled twice. Ice blocks need to be “thawed” first (according to the level rules). Key blocks are linked to channels—filling them can open or change coffee paths. Dynamite starts a timer: you must fill all blocks before it explodes.
5. Boosters
Use boosters from the shop when you need them—they help simplify tricky layouts or speed up filling.
6. Losing and retrying
If the dynamite goes off or you don’t complete the level, you can restart and try a different sequence of moves.
